English: Birnau Basilica is a pilgrimage church at the banks of
Lake Constance , between
Meersburg and
Überlingen . It was built in 1746-1749 for the Cistercians monastery of
Salem (Germany) by Austrian architect
Peter Thumb . The church interior features notable frescoes by
Gottfried Bernhard Göz as well as altars and stucco ornaments in rococo style by
Joseph Anton Feuchtmayer .
